Umesh Kumari

Umesh Kumari is a prominent provincial public figure in Aligarh, Uttar Pradesh, the largest state of the Union of India. She works actively in three fields: politics, social work and education.
Early life
Umesh Kumari was born in the small village of Sahara Khurd in Aligarh district of the Indian state of Uttar Pradesh in a Jat family. His father was Girwar Singh, who was Village Mukhiya (Pradhan) for consecutive 5 terms, i.e., 25 years. She was born in a family of farmers and went on to secure a bachelor's degree in science (BSC), master's degrees in history, economics, political science (MA) and education (M.ed). She is doctrate (PHD) in Indian History.
Umesh Kumari got married in a family of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h workers in Gonda, Aligarh . Her father in law Shri Prabhakar Singh Verma was an active RSS Jila Sangh Chalak. So She obviously got associated with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h in 1980's and remains connected till now.
Political career
In 1989, Dr. Umesh Kumari was appointed District President of bhartiya janta party women wing in three districts : Aligarh Village, Aligarh Mahanagar and Hathras. She played an important role in connecting to women cadres during Ram Mandir Aandolan (1989-1995). In 1995, She won the elections of Member and Chairperson of the district board of then unified Aligarh and Hathras districts. This electoral victory was significant because there was Samajwadi party (SP) government in the Uttar Pradesh at that time and Mulayam Singh Yadav was the chief minister. So only very few districts were wone by BJP. In 2001, Dr. Umesh Kumari was made Vibhag Sanyojak by BJP Uttar Pradesh Unit to work in five districts : Aligarh Village, Aligarh City, Hathras, Kasganj and Etah, the post she occupied till 2007. She also fought member of legislative assembly (MLA) election on BJP ticket in 2002 and 2007. She was also appointed the member of the executive council of BJP Uttar Pradesh unit for three years.
Educational Carrier
Dr. Umesh kumari worked as leturer in Lagasama Inter College, Gonda, Aligarh between 1989 to 2011. In 2011, She became principal of Uttam Inter College, Aligarh. She has been very vocal on issues related to spread and problems of education and organised many conferences, protests and programs in this regard. She is also serving as Uttar Pradesh Secretary of Uttar Pradesh Principal Council, Lucknow. In July 2015, She was appointed as the President of the Aligarh Unit of council. Since 2009 till now, Umesh Kumari is also serving as the president of Saraswati Vidya Mandir, a famous English medium senior secondary school, situated at Khair road, Aligarh.
Social Work
Apart from association with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h, Umesh Kumari also works for issues related to farmers. She was appointed member of Food Corporation of India by Atal Bihari Vajpayee government. She is also a strong supporter of women empowerment and works in this direction. As a scholar in Indian history, she argues the role of Subhas Chandra Bose should be rewritten and emphasised more in the new context. Since 2009, she has been trustee of Netaji Subhas-INA Trust, New Delhi. The trust has been demanding the complete declassification of Netaji files and creation of a Netaji memorial in New delhi.
